Today, this software dinosaur makes a comeback, recompiled into \u00a064-bit\u00a0, ready to run on \u00a0Windows 11\u00a0. A technological memory lane\u2026 but at your own risk.<\/p>\n<div class=\"ln__a-dc is--in-article\">\n    <span class=\"ln__a-dc__lbl is--top ln__body-sm\">Advertisement, your content continues below<\/span>\n<\/div>\n<h2 class=\"ed__a-t\" id=\"cd2wav32-revient-des-morts-et-tourne-en-64-bits-sur-windows-11\">CD2WAV32 Rises from the Dead, Now Runs in 64 Bits on Windows 11<\/h2>\n<p class=\"ed__a-p ed__bdy__l\">It took some audacity to revive a utility designed in the era of \u00a0Windows 95\u00a0 and make it functional in \u00a02025\u00a0 on \u00a0Windows 11\u00a0 (24H2) as a \u00a064-bit\u00a0 application. Yet, that is precisely what developer \u00a0Moroboshi Ramu\u00a0 set out to do, driven merely by curiosity to see if the tool still worked. The result? \u00a0CD2WAV32\u00a0 has been meticulously recompil-ed using \u00a0Delphi 12.1 Community Edition\u00a0, free from its outdated \u00a016-bit calls\u00a0, and now features a display tailored for \u00a04K\u00a0 screens.<\/p>\n<p class=\"ed__a-p ed__bdy__l\">To be frank, the practical interest remains somewhat \u00a0limited\u00a0. Firstly, the interface is entirely in \u00a0Japanese\u00a0. Secondly, \u00a0Windows Media Player\u00a0 has been more than capable of ripping CDs for years, rendering such relics of technology mostly \u00a0unnecessary\u00a0. However, the release carries a certain scent of \u00a0nostalgia\u00a0, serving as a demonstration that even the most forgotten software can \u00a0survive\u00a0\u2014provided someone remains interested in reviving it.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<div>\n<p class=\"ed__a-p ed__bdy__l\">From a technical standpoint, the shift to \u00a064 bits\u00a0 addresses several \u00a0overflow issues\u00a0 that arise with large files. The management of \u00a0metadata\u00a0 has also been enhanced, even for larger disks. Thus, we say goodbye to \u00a0TwinVQ\u00a0 and \u00a0MSCDEX\u00a0, ancient components from the era of \u00a0Windows 3.x\u00a0 that are incompatible with the modern architecture of \u00a0Windows 11\u00a0. We also notice a change in font: \u00a0Meiryo 10pt\u00a0 replaces the venerable \u00a0MSP Gothic\u00a0.<\/p>\n<p class=\"ed__a-p ed__bdy__l\">But what about \u00a0Windows 10\u00a0? The developer mentions that it has only been briefly tested on an old \u00a0Atom PC\u00a0 but seems to operate just fine. There&#8217;s no formal commitment: if it works, that\u2019s great!<\/p>\n<div class=\"ln__a-dc is--in-article\">\n    <span class=\"ln__a-dc__lbl is--top ln__body-sm\">Advertisement, your content continues below<\/span>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<h2 id=\"cd2wav32-and-the-nostalgia-factor\">CD2WAV32 and the Nostalgia Factor<\/h2>\n<p class=\"ed__a-p ed__bdy__l\">In an age dominated by cloud storage and \u00a0digital music\u00a0, the idea of using a tool like CD2WAV32 can feel like a flashback to a simpler time.
